Output be72e6036e126f9da692cc5de47dfefb6fc42316cda92a74ddfa3ae824a2b5c2:28

value
17817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a6f9ea4a1758cf0c8d55e0d90ba2d3ddc4b98a OP_EQUAL
address
3MFzZJnMDGnP8UKDHffkw6LwdC5xb7T6WD
transaction
be72e6036e126f9da692cc5de47dfefb6fc42316cda92a74ddfa3ae824a2b5c2
confirmations
245618
spent
true